Michael McHugh was called to the NSW Bar in 1999 and appointed silk in 2012. Michael maintains a wide ranging trial and appellate practice across civil and criminal jurisdictions. He acts regularly as a commercial arbitrator and is recommended as leading senior counsel in transport matters in Doyle’s guide. He has also enjoyed roles as secretary and treasurer of the NSW Bar Association and regularly publishes, including parts of the Thomson Reuters Loose-leaf: NSW Civil Practice & Procedure.
